What is the average salary in Lockhart, TX?

The average salary in Lockhart, TX is $49,654 per year.

Lockhart, TX offers a variety of job opportunities with competitive salaries. The average yearly salary in Lockhart is $49,654. This figure reflects the diverse economic landscape of the area. Many jobs provide salaries that match or exceed this average, making Lockhart a favorable place for job seekers.


The salary distribution in Lockhart shows a broad range of earnings. The most common salary range is between $29,948 and $38,246. This range covers a significant portion of the workforce, indicating a healthy mix of entry-level and mid-level positions. Higher-paying jobs, with salaries above $79,737, are also available, offering opportunities for career growth and advancement.

What are the best paying jobs in Lockhart, TX?

Lockhart, TX, offers several top-paying jobs for job seekers. Registered Nurses earn the highest average salary at $72,446. This role involves providing patient care and support. Licensed Vocational Nurses also earn a strong salary, averaging $59,524. These professionals assist doctors and nurses in patient care. Other well-paying jobs in Lockhart include Delivery Drivers and Customer Service Representatives. Delivery Drivers earn a solid average salary of $33,211. They transport goods and ensure timely deliveries. Customer Service Representatives earn $24,400 on average. They help clients with inquiries and support their needs. These jobs provide good earning potential and valuable skills.

How does the cost of living in Lockhart, TX compare to the national average?

Lockhart, TX, offers a cost of living that is slightly below the nationwide average. The overall cost of living index for Lockhart is 91, which is 9% lower than the national average of 100. This makes Lockhart an attractive option for those looking to manage living expenses more effectively. Specifically, Lockhart's housing costs are 15% below the national average, while groceries and utilities are just 5% and 2% below, respectively. Transportation and healthcare costs are also slightly lower, at 10% and 8% below the national average. This balanced reduction across various categories makes Lockhart a cost-effective choice for many job seekers.
